Can we customize anti-fog safety glasses with logos?
Article Title: Can we customize anti-fog safety glasses with logos?
Quick Summary
Yes — customization is practical but conditional. Logo placement, imprint method, ink/curing chemistry and production controls determine whether anti‑fog performance or safety certification is compromised. Prioritize branding on frames/temples, use low‑temperature UV inks or compatible laser marking, run adhesion and fog tests, and preserve ANSI/EN certification during production.

FAQ
Can anti-fog safety glasses be branded with company logos?
Yes — but with constraints. The anti‑fog treatment is typically a surface coating applied to the lens inner face; many anti‑fog coatings are hydrophilic polymer films that spread condensation into an invisible layer. Direct printing or harsh surface modification on that coated area can abrade, chemically attack, or change the wetting properties that produce the anti‑fog effect. Practical, reliable approaches are: place logos on frames or temples rather than on the lens inner surface; if a lens mark is required, use indirect methods such as printing on the lens outer face with UV‑curable inks validated not to interfere with the coating, or apply logo elements between lens layers in laminated constructions. Always run production samples and fog performance tests after decoration to confirm no degradation.
What imprinting methods work best on anti-fog polycarbonate lenses?
For polycarbonate lenses the safest, most common choices are: 1) Avoid lens interior printing. 2) On frames/temples: pad printing, UV digital printing, laser marking (on compatible substrates) and hot‑foil stamping are proven. 3) On lens exterior: low‑temperature UV‑cured screen or digital inks can work if the ink formulation and curing process do not attack or heat the anti‑fog coating; curing temperature must be controlled and solvent exposure minimized. 4) Laser engraving on polycarbonate lenses is generally not recommended — it can pit or cloud the lens. For any chosen method, request manufacturer data sheets for inks/adhesives, run adhesion (cross‑cut/rub) tests, and validate anti‑fog behavior with the decorated sample.
Does anti-fog coating interfere with pad printing or laser etching?
It can. Pad printing typically uses inks and solvents; if applied directly onto an anti‑fog coating these solvents can soften or remove the coating or prevent proper ink adhesion. Laser etching interacts with polymer chemistry and heat — on lenses it risks ablating the coating or causing micro‑fractures that reduce optical clarity and compromise anti‑fog performance. The industry workaround is to brand non‑coated areas (frames/temples) or to specify inks and curing processes explicitly tested for compatibility. Where lens marking is indispensable, perform small‑scale trials and independent fog/optical tests before scaling to production.
Minimum order quantities for custom logo anti-fog safety glasses wholesale?
MOQ varies by factory, decoration type and tooling needs. Typical ranges for private‑label safety eyewear are: 300–1,000 units for pad printing or standard color runs, and 1,000+ units if custom mold colorants, bespoke lens coatings or new tooling are required. Shorter MOQ options exist through digital printing or inventory of blank frames, but custom lens coatings or certification rework increases MOQ. How to ensure logo durability on anti-fog treated eyewear frames?
Durability requires three controls: substrate preparation, proper ink/marking chemistry, and validated curing. For plastic frames (nylon, polycarbonate, TR‑90) use primers or surface treatments when required, choose inks rated for flexible plastics, and cure per ink supplier recommendations (prefer UV cure to minimize heat). Conduct adhesion tests (cross‑cut, tape, and abrasion rub tests) and environmental aging (UV exposure and humidity cycles). For temples/frames that contact skin, use inks compliant with skin‑contact regulations. Document test results and include acceptance criteria in the purchase order to avoid disputes at scale.
Lead times and certifications for private-label anti-fog safety glasses?
Typical lead time workflow: prototype/sample 1–2 weeks (if off‑the‑shelf frames), sample customization and testing 2–4 weeks, mass production 3–6 weeks depending on volume and decoration. Total project lead time commonly ranges from 6–12 weeks. Regarding certifications: safety eyewear frequently requires ANSI Z87.1 (US) or EN166 (EU) compliance; anti‑fog treatments do not replace impact or optical requirements. If a decoration or process changes the lens or frame material, re‑testing may be necessary. Plan for certification checks into lead time, and require the manufacturer to supply test reports or to perform testing at accredited labs before shipment to ensure compliance for volume orders.
